2. Psychology of Mankind and the Reality

To mankind the love of worldly appetites is painted in glowing colours: women and children, and heaped-up
mounds of gold and silver, and horses with fine markings, and livestock and fertile farmland. All that is merely
the enjoyment of the life of this world. The best homecoming is in the presence of Allah.

(Holy Quran, Surah Al ‘Imran (The Family Of 'Imran, The House Of 'Imran), Surah # 3: Ayah # 14)

Scenario of running Horses, Psychology of Mankind and the Reality:
By the charging horses panting hard, striking sparks from their flashing hooves, raiding at full gallop in the early dawn, leaving a trailing dust cloud in their wake, cleaving through the middle of the foe, truly man is ungrateful to his Lord and indeed he bears witness to that.
(Holy Quran, Surah Al ‘Adiyat (Those That Run), Surah # 100: Ayah # 1-7)
